The Clare School Governing Body
The Governing Body is responsible for the strategic leadership of the school and has a vital role to play in making sure that every child gets the best possible education. School governors are volunteers, reflecting the diversity of the school, local community and business community. We work together as a Governing Body to collectively oversee the development of The Clare School. Representatives from all backgrounds and varying ages bring different perspectives to the decision-making process, working closely together for the benefit of the school and its pupils.
At The Clare School, our Governing Body comprises 10 Governors – 3 Parent Governors, 2 Staff Governors, 1 Local Authority Governor, 2 Foundation Trust Governors, 1 Community Governor and we also have 1 Associate Governor.

The Governing Body has a number of formal committees including:
- Strategy
- Finance & Premises
- Curriculum
- Personnel
Safeguarding sits under Tina Minns as the named Lead Governor for Safeguarding, who liaises frequently with the Senior designated staff at the school.
There are also other panels and formal groups that are convened as necessary to ensure the efficient and effective running of the school.
